Chalkboard Refrigerator


This weekend Kevin and I did one of our many projects. We think it is so much fun to make little changes in our house. We got this refrigerator a couple of years ago when we moved in for $20. Talk about a deal! I hated it because it was white and gross and didn't go with any of our brand new appliances. Kevin said to just be patient and we would get a new one soon. Well, those things are really expensive and we just never got around to getting one. One day while surfing the net I found this wonderful idea. I told Kevin and he said sure lets do it. So, one trip to Home Depot for some $12.99 chalkboard paint and now we have a great canvas. I loved how it turned out. We decided we would have a weekly Bible verse and would add random things. I got some really cute "m" and "k" magnets and I love them. I bought an extra can of paint so that when school starts back up I can do some cute thinks in my classroom.
